Gerrymandering is the practice of manipulating electoral district boundaries for political advantage. However, there are several synonyms for the term that can be used to describe similar practices. Some commonly used synonyms include redistricting, vote packing, and stacking. Other related terms include "cracking" and "packing" which refer to dividing or concentrating voters to maximize or minimize their representation respectively. In essence, gerrymandering is a political tactic that can undermine democratic principles and reduce the effectiveness of each citizen's voice in elections. Synonyms for gerrymandering highlight the tactics employed to distort electoral outcomes and the impact on democratic representation.
